[0001] This utility model belongs to the technical field of wall and column corner formwork fixing, specifically relating to an interlocking high-efficiency formwork fastening construction tool. Background Technology

[0002] Tie bolt fastening is a relatively traditional method of formwork securing. It involves drilling holes along the edges of the formwork and then using bolts and nuts to connect two or more formwork panels together. Workers then use tools such as wrenches to tighten the nuts, creating tension in the bolts and thus firmly securing the formwork. For example, in the installation of building wall formwork, bolt holes are set at regular intervals along the vertical and horizontal edges of the formwork. After the bolts are installed, tightening the nuts applies a securing force, ensuring the integrity and stability of the formwork.

[0003] Advantages: Strong and stable fastening force. It can withstand significant concrete pouring pressure and is less prone to formwork deformation or displacement. In formwork construction of large building structures, such as the core tube formwork of high-rise buildings, bolt fastening provides reliable fixation; the technology is mature and easy for construction workers to master. Because this technology has been used for many years, most construction workers are familiar with its operation, requiring no additional complex training.

[0004] Disadvantages: The installation and disassembly process is relatively cumbersome. It requires drilling holes in the formwork, installing bolts and nuts, and unscrewing each nut individually during disassembly, which is time-consuming. This increases the construction period and labor costs; the bolt holes can cause some damage to the formwork. Repeatedly used formwork is prone to cracks and damage around the bolt holes, affecting its lifespan.

[0005] like Figure 1 As shown: To address the shortcomings of using tie bolts to fasten formwork, utility model patent CN222375995U discloses a corner formwork reinforcement device, including an L-shaped screw, a sleeve, an angle steel, and a nut. The angle steel is fixed to the sleeve, which is fitted onto the horizontal bar of the L-shaped screw. The vertical bar of the L-shaped screw and the angle steel clamp the back ribs on the two formwork panels at the corner. The nut is screwed onto the horizontal bar of the L-shaped screw to apply a preload. Although this corner formwork reinforcement device improves upon the drawbacks of using tie bolts to fasten formwork, it suffers from the problem of single-point clamping and stress concentration. Utility Model Content

[0006] This invention aims to solve the problem that existing corner template reinforcement devices can only clamp at a single point, resulting in stress concentration during clamping.

[0007] This utility model provides the following technical solution: a high-efficiency interlocking template fastening construction tool, including a scissor-type interlocking bracket, a control mechanism connected to the top of the middle hinge shaft of the scissor-type interlocking bracket, and a clamping part provided at the bottom of the outer hinge shaft of the scissor-type interlocking bracket. The control mechanism can control the extension and retraction of the scissor-type interlocking bracket to adjust the distance between the clamping parts on both sides. The clamping parts on both sides can clamp and fix the external corner template.

[0008] Furthermore, the control mechanism includes a front support, a rear support, and a tie rod. The front support and the rear support are respectively mounted on the middle hinge shafts at the beginning and end of the scissor-type interlocking bracket. The front support is provided with a screw hole, and the rear support is provided with a light hole coaxial with the screw hole. The tie rod passes through the light hole of the rear support and is threaded into the screw hole of the front support. The stop block on the tie rod stops at the rear support.

[0009] Furthermore, the control mechanism also includes a guide seat, which is mounted on the intermediate hinge shaft of the scissor-type interlocking bracket between the front support and the rear support. The guide seat is provided with a light hole, and the pull rod passes through the light hole of the guide seat.

[0010] Furthermore, the tie rod is a bolt, and the bolt head of the tie rod is stopped by the rear support.

[0011] Furthermore, the clamping part includes a clamping plate and a sleeve, the sleeve being fitted onto the extended shaft section of the outer hinge shaft of the scissor-type interlocking bracket, and the clamping plate being centrally fixed on the sleeve.

[0012] Compared with the prior art, the advantages of this utility model are: This utility model provides a high-efficiency interlocking formwork fastening construction tool. Through the structural design of the scissor-type interlocking bracket, the clamping part can act on multiple positions of the formwork simultaneously, achieving uniform clamping of the external corner formwork. This effectively avoids the stress concentration problem caused by the traditional single-point clamping method, improving the overall stability and safety of the formwork. The control mechanism realizes the extension and retraction of the scissor-type bracket through the cooperation of the pull rod and the thread, which can precisely adjust the distance between the clamping parts on both sides to adapt to the construction needs of formwork of different thicknesses. [0016] like Figure 2 , Figure 3 As shown: A high-efficiency interlocking formwork fastening construction tool includes a scissor-type interlocking bracket 1. The scissor-type interlocking bracket 1 is formed by multiple sets of connecting rods that are cross-hinged through hinge shafts to form a telescopic parallelogram mechanism. A control mechanism is connected to the top of the middle hinge shaft of the scissor-type interlocking bracket 1, and a clamping part is provided at the bottom of the outer hinge shaft of the scissor-type interlocking bracket 1. The control mechanism can control the extension and retraction of the scissor-type interlocking bracket 1 to adjust the distance between the clamping parts on both sides. The clamping parts on both sides can clamp and fix the external corner formwork.

[0017] The control mechanism includes a front support 2, a rear support 3, and a tie rod 4. The front support 2 and the rear support 3 are respectively mounted on the intermediate hinge shafts at the beginning and end of the scissor-type interlocking bracket 1. The front support 2 is provided with a screw hole, and the rear support 3 is provided with a smooth hole coaxial with the screw hole. The tie rod 4 passes through the smooth hole of the rear support 3 and is threaded into the screw hole of the front support 2. The stop block on the tie rod 4 stops at the rear support 3. The tie rod 4 is a bolt, and the bolt head of the tie rod 4 stops at the rear support 3.

[0018] The clamping part includes a clamping plate 6 and a sleeve 7. The sleeve 7 is sleeved on the extended shaft of the outer hinge shaft of the scissor-type interlocking bracket 1 and can rotate around it. The clamping plate 6 is fixed in the center on the sleeve 7.

[0019] The threaded drive generates axial tension. When the pull rod 4 is turned, its head is stopped on the rear support 3, and the thread engages with the front support 2. The rotational motion is converted into axial linear motion in which the front support 2 and the rear support 3 move closer or further apart. This axial motion is converted into lateral extension and retraction. The opposing or receding movements of the front support 2 and the rear support 3 force the hinge angle of the entire scissor-type interlocking bracket 1 to change, thereby converting the axial displacement of the control mechanism into the lateral opening or contraction of the clamping parts on both sides.

[0020] The clamping parts on both sides are pressed synchronously and parallel onto the template back ribs on both sides of the external corner by clamping plates 6. Due to the characteristics of the scissor structure, the applied clamping force is evenly distributed to multiple hinge points and clamping parts, effectively avoiding stress concentration at a single point.

[0021] By simply using a wrench to tighten a single lever 4, the entire process of opening, positioning, tightening, and disassembling the tool can be completed quickly, taking only a fraction of the time of traditional tie bolts or single-point reinforcement devices, significantly improving construction efficiency.

[0022] The control mechanism also includes a guide seat 5, which is installed on the intermediate hinge shaft of the scissor bite bracket 1 between the front support 2 and the rear support 3. The guide seat 5 is provided with a light hole, and the pull rod 4 passes through the light hole of the guide seat 5; this increases the connection rigidity between the pull rod 4 and the scissor bite bracket 1, and the scissor bite bracket 1 can extend and retract linearly with the pull rod 4 as the guide.

[0023] The use of the interlocking high-efficiency formwork fastening construction tool in this embodiment can effectively improve the efficiency of construction operations. After applying this tool, the operation time can be reduced by half compared with the traditional formwork reinforcement method, the construction efficiency is significantly improved, and the labor utilization rate is high.

[0024] This tool was used in the main structure formwork construction of the first phase of the Huozhou Coal and Electricity Group Huiyuan Residential Building Project and the Anhui Hospital of Beijing Tiantan Hospital affiliated to Capital Medical University. Before its use, one person could complete 20 square meters of traditional formwork reinforcement per day. After using the special tool, one person could complete 60 × 2 = 40 square meters per day, saving 0.5 manpower and construction time. Based on the fact that the project is a high-rise residential building with 25 floors above ground and 2 floors below ground, and the vertical formwork area of ​​a single floor is 2000 square meters, the calculation is: 2000 × 27 floors ÷ 20 square meters / man-day / person = 2700 man-days, 2700 × 0.5 = 1350 man-days. Based on the carpenter's labor unit price of 500 yuan / man-day, the cost saving is: 500 yuan / man-day × 1350 man-days = 675,000 yuan.
